Icarus couldn't help but find it interesting that the climb that Demetri had been so insistent they take had downed him so easily. Icarus had looked on as his herd mates struggled to find their breath and hesitated to continue. But Saria took charge and with some help from the new mare, the rest of the unit was headed back down the slopes. Icarus felt strangely called to continue and with few words turned to do so. The following hours washed over the stallion in silence. The occasional mountain breeze whistled by but the golden stallion continued to climb ever higher. The nervous fluttering in his chest he had felt when they had first started to gain altitude had steadied into a rhythmic drumming that seemed to drive his steps.

The sky seemed to disappear as the path became shrouded with mist. Not once did his steps falter as he continued to climb ever higher. It was only when the heavy mist began to lift that the golden stallion snapped out of his pace. Was that...surely not...he could have sworn he smelled apples. They were a rare enough treat back down on earth but up here? How was that even possible? The stallion slowed as he took a turn off the pebble stern path and quickly realized he was once again walking on grass. His eyes flickered down as he noticed the thick and untouched carpet of greenery that seemed to wrap around the mountain.

He turned another bend and stuttered to a stop. His breath caught as his eyes landed on the forgotten place his vision had shown him. Apple trees spotted with golden fruit grew wild out of various crevices which explained the smell. But his eyes landed on the lichen and vines covered entrance he had briefly seen months ago. Sucking down a short breath he slowly continued forward as he examined the ruin.

It was a miracle it stood at all, perched so close to the edge of a drop off. It had not survived without harm however which was evident by the overgrown chunks of stone and toppled marble pillars. He had to wonder what it must have looked like in his hay day, what a glorious place it must have been. Icarus hesitated as he neared the pitch black entrance of the temple, ears perked forward was he listened to the wind whistle and hiss through the entrance.

As mystical as this place was, it wasn't so charming as to completely render the stallion free of his common sense. This place was decrepit and there was no telling what was lurking inside. He licked his lips, finding his mouth suddenly parched as he tried to swallow the lump in his throat. He...he knew he had to go in. Something was calling him there, calling him home but the logical part of his brain was just entirely too loud.

"I...I can peek in. No harm in that..." He whispered to himself, exhaling loudly to steady himself before inching forward. He tried to focus on the sweet scent of those apples to calm his nerves as he leaned his head inside. It may have been pitch black from the outside but after a beat his eyes adjusted to the dark. Inside, it was clear there had been one or several earth tremors over the years.

Stones scattered the floor which looked like it was also made of marble. Now cracked and in desperate need of a polish, he moved forward tentatively as he peered about. A small part of him worried that something might be living here. Could trolls make it up this high up? He couldn't remember but gods that was the last thing he needed to find right now. He gave his head a shake and focused on the cracked murals that had survived whatever had happened here.

He was reminded of what Saria and Demetri had spoke of, that their temples had also been decorated with the illustrations of great deeds. He was surprised to see that this place was a little more decorated than what they had described. In addition to the murals he soon laid eyes upon a large statue in the center of the main chamber. The horn had long since been broken off but most of the rearing unicorn was still in tact. What was most impressive about the statue however were the massive wings which were still in tact and filled most of the room. He had always heard rumors, stories even of unicorns who had been so blessed but it was something else entirely to see it.

He took a moment to stand in the shadow of this statue as his eyes washed over it. Light was filtering into the temple from small cracks in the ceiling which also grabbed Icarus' attention. Was this some sort of trickery or had the ancient architects somehow planned for that. His eyes washed over the statue again, regarding the fierce expression of the figure who had reared up and was kicking their front legs. Icarus couldn't help but smirk a little, thinking to himself how impressive it would be to, somehow, grow wings of his own. It would certainly put Demetri's pathetic little flower trick to shame. To leave the earth entirely...to be able to fly like the dragons?

He shelved the idea and hummed softly to himself as he moved past the statue. He paused as he eyed the stretch of hallway that opened up behind the statueΒ  and presented him with several options. He could seem six other hallways, three on each side that lead to unknown rooms. One entrance way had collapsed completely so he was hopeful that the mural he needed wasn't in there. With another sigh he chuckled to himself, ears flickering around in surprise as how the noise echoed around him so loudly.
"Welp...I guess I just go one by one.." He whispered to himself before striding forward once more. He just hoped this place was still stable enough not to collapse on his head.
